CODE代码:
sudo apt-get update
sudo apt-get install module-assistant build-essential
sudo apt-get install fakeroot dh-make debconf libstdc++5 linux-headers-$(uname -r)
创建deb包
CODE代码:
sudo ln -sf bash /bin/sh
bash ati-driver-installer-8.29.6.run --buildpkg Ubuntu/edgy
sudo ln -sf dash /bin/sh
安装驱动
CODE代码:
sudo dpkg -i xorg-driver-fglrx_8.29.6-1_i386.deb
sudo dpkg -i fglrx-kernel-source_8.29.6-1_i386.deb
sudo dpkg -i fglrx-control_8.29.6-1_i386.deb
移除旧的fglrx
CODE代码:
sudo rm /usr/src/fglrx-kernel*.deb
编译
CODE代码:
sudo module-assistant prepare
sudo module-assistant update
sudo module-assistant build fglrx
cd /usr/src
sudo dpkg -i fglrx-kernel-*
sudo depmod -a
配置驱动
CODE代码:
sudo dpkg-reconfigure xserver-xorg
然后
CODE代码:
sudo aticonfig --ovt=Xv
并且
CODE代码:
sudo gedit /etc/X11/xorg.conf
添加一段
CODE代码:
Section "Extensions"
Option "Composite" "0"
EndSection
加载模块
CODE代码:
sudo rmmod -f fglrx
sudo depmod -a
sudo modprobe fglrx
重启x
ubuntu:
CODE代码:
sudo /etc/init.d/gdm force-reload
kubuntu:
CODE代码:
sudo /etc/init.d/kdm force-reload
重启系统
确认驱动是否正确安装
CODE代码:
$ fglrxinfo
display: :0.0 screen: 0
OpenGL vendor string: ATI Technologies Inc.
OpenGL renderer string: RADEON 9700 Generic
OpenGL version string: 2.0.6065 (8.29.6)
CODE代码:
$ glxinfo | grep render
direct rendering: Yes
-------------------------------------------------------------------------
如果你碰到2D加速很慢的情况,在/etc/X11/xorg.conf 的 Device section(就是有fglrx的那段)中添上
CODE代码:
Option "XaaNoOffscreenPixmaps"